Output 23fb1d8c14bddfb2488e01ebc95944dbf5bed798f08112a1b143bedc4794508c:17

value
21069518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a59513c1ffe2826fa51aec8481c6587f50c9016 OP_EQUAL
address
32djgLayqFCGgNYBHL2GfdnxTJa2Ry1ihC
transaction
23fb1d8c14bddfb2488e01ebc95944dbf5bed798f08112a1b143bedc4794508c
spent
true